Let's take a moment together to reset and breathe.

Find a comfortable position - whether you're sitting, standing, or lying down. Close your eyes if that feels good, or soften your gaze. Begin to notice your natural breath, without trying to change anything. Just observe. Imagine your breath as a gentle river, flowing effortlessly through your body. No force, no pressure - just natural, fluid movement.

Notice where your breath moves most easily. Maybe it's a slight expansion in your chest, a subtle rise and fall in your belly, or a soft movement in your ribcage. Your breath is always here, always moving, always supporting you - even when you're not paying attention.

Now, let's explore a gentle breathing technique I call "Ocean Waves Breathing." Imagine your breath is like the rhythmic waves of the ocean - sometimes soft and barely perceptible, sometimes with more depth and power. Inhale slowly, counting to four, feeling your lungs gently expand like the tide rolling in. Then exhale for a count of six, releasing tension like waves receding from the shore.

With each breath, you're creating a little space between yourself and whatever feels challenging right now. You're not trying to fix or change anything - just witnessing, just breathing. If your mind wanders, that's perfectly okay. Simply notice, and return to the rhythm of your breath, like a kind friend guiding you back home.

As we complete our practice, take a moment to appreciate yourself. You showed up. You took time to breathe, to be present, to care for yourself. Carry this sense of gentle awareness with you through your day - like a quiet, internal compass guiding you.
